NUCLEAR MAGNETIC RESONANCE STRUCTURE OF AN SH2 DOMAIN OF PHOSPHOLIPASE C-GAMMA1 COMPLEXED WITH A HIGH AFFINITY BINDING PEPTIDE

About this Structure

2PLD is a Protein complex structure of sequences from Bos taurus. Full experimental information is available from OCA.

Reference

Nuclear magnetic resonance structure of an SH2 domain of phospholipase C-gamma 1 complexed with a high affinity binding peptide., Pascal SM, Singer AU, Gish G, Yamazaki T, Shoelson SE, Pawson T, Kay LE, Forman-Kay JD, Cell. 1994 May 6;77(3):461-72. PMID:8181064
